Back once again with the real renegade master! Richard D. James AKA Aphex Twin unleashes his first new work since the 1999 classic ‘Windowlicker’ in a low key, limited edition white label stylee.
Everyone’s favourite electronic mentalist brings an early acid house style melody kicking and screaming into the 21st century via his searing electro attack. Terrifying ‘Come to Daddy’ style vocals (if you can call them that) kick in at the end to round off this fortnight’s most deranged release.
Aphex will finally release a thirty track double album later in the year entitled Drukqs – I’m not joking – and none of these tracks will be on it. To be snapped up while stocks last.
